What is Flexible Ski Resort Accounting?

Flexible Ski Resort Accounting refers to accounting roles at ski resorts that offer adaptable work schedules, such as part-time, seasonal, or remote work options. These positions involve managing the resort’s financial records, processing payments, budgeting, and ensuring compliance with financial regulations. Flexibility in these roles allows employees to accommodate peak seasonal workloads and adjust to the unique operational needs of ski resorts, making them ideal for those seeking work-life balance or seasonal employment.

What is the difference between Flexible Ski Resort Accounting vs Ski Resort Bookkeeper?

AspectFlexible Ski Resort AccountingSki Resort Bookkeeper
CredentialsAccounting certifications (e.g., CPA), relevant industry experienceBasic bookkeeping or accounting certifications, experience in resort settings
Work EnvironmentOffice-based, on-site at ski resorts, or remoteOn-site at ski resorts, handling daily financial transactions
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by ski resorts for comprehensive financial managementEmployed by ski resorts for daily bookkeeping tasks

Flexible Ski Resort Accounting involves managing complex financial strategies, budgets, and financial planning for ski resorts, often requiring advanced certifications. Ski Resort Bookkeepers focus on recording daily transactions, invoicing, and maintaining financial records. While both roles support the resort's financial health, accounting professionals handle broader financial analysis, whereas bookkeepers focus on routine record-keeping.
